Global Serials Intelligence Comprehensive data collection and verification about serials and their providers Ulrich’s is comprehensive Worldwide coverage of titles and publishers Serials in all languages and subjects Inclusive coverage of all media formats Ulrich’s is verified Managed by a professional staff 325,000 Title Authority records 103,000 Provider Authority records

Ulrich’s Collects and Verifies for You CaptureCorrectCompileConnect Where do we get the data? How do we clean the data? What do we add to the data? Where does the data go? Publisher outreach EDI feeds Web-based research New data forms ‘Checklists’ Catalogs Verify details Verify status Validate ISSN Standardize titles Apply authority rules Link titles to provider & supplier records Bibliographic data Subjects Content descriptions Links to related serials Reviews TOCs Ulrich’s services Access tools Management tools Data tools Libraries Consortia Patrons Researchers

Superior metadata treatment Work directly with content providers to receive the best metadata Merge metadata elements to create superior records Provide full text indexing for better discovery Index and preserve subject terms from all taxonomies Add Journal Authority, Ulrich’s peer review data, WoS Citation Counts Serials Solutions expertise results in rich metadata optimized for discovery = Enriched Summon Records

Merging Example Summon Record Sage: Full Text Gale/ProQuest: abstracts and subject terms CrossRef: DOI Ulrich’s: Peer-reviewed status Web of Science: additional author plus citation counts The most complete representation of all metadata from all sources merged into a single record
